COVID RNA in the brain

edit

The journal Nature reported that during autopsies, SARS-CoV-2 RNA had been detected in multiple anatomic sites, including the brain, up to 230 days after symptom onset in one case.[1] My question is whether it is common for other non-SARS-CoV-2 viruses to be detected in the brain, and how does the 230 day post-infection detection window, as claimed here, compare to what we know about other viruses? Uhooep (talk) 01:51, 15 January 2023 (UTC)[reply]

Ebolavirus was found in patients' testes and eyes a year after they recovered, and in the case of the testes, actually infected a patient's sexual partner. Note that the eyes and testes are also protected by barriers like the blood-brain immune barrier. It seems likely that all viruses can hide from the immune system behind these barriers. Abductive (reasoning) 05:31, 15 January 2023 (UTC)[reply]
HIV and herpes simplex have also been shown to be able "hide" in the brain – that is, remain present without causing any clinical symptoms. The generalization to "all viruses" is quite a leap.  --Lambiam 12:06, 15 January 2023 (UTC)[reply]
So, every virus checked so far... In other words, "likely", all viruses. Abductive (reasoning) 20:40, 15 January 2023 (UTC)[reply]

Sometimes it is possible to show an impossibility on theoretical grounds; compare the pumping lemma for regular languages, which can be used to show that the context-free languages are a proper superset of the regular languages, a simple example of a CF language that is not regular being  (n )n – any number of opening brackets matched by an equal number of closing brackets. In particular, the recursive embedding of phrases seen in many natural languages including English cannot be properly attained by a generative Markov chain model, barring anacolutha. In English as in most other languages, a minute twist to a sentence can dramatically change its whole meaning. To be able to respond with the level of adequacy displayed, the model needs to perform a structural analysis of the input, and produce output that is also structurally coherent, with semantic elements being coordinated throughout. Is this apparent structural ability an emergent aspect of the statistical process, given enough context? When I read "GPT-3 takes the prompt, converts the input into a list of tokens, processes the prompt, and converts the predicted tokens back to the words we see in the response",[1] and "Large language models generate text token by token",[2] I can't help but think of an overblown Markov chain model. A few remarks. I have not underlined the "stop words" of the list found as the third item at Stop word § External links. Although the form wilt occurs in the sonnets, it is as the second-person singular form of the verb will (I will, thou wilt ), so I have also not underlined this. The words pride and bright occur as rhyming words, but not as a rhyming pair – Shakespeare's rhymes are proper ones. The words woe and show also occur as rhyming words, but again, not as a pair. None of ChatGPT's rhyming pairs is found in the sonnets, and I did not spot obviously similar phrases or tropes. Inversions of the word order as seen in "Gone is the lily's radiance and grace" are rare; one occurrence is in Sonnet CV ("Kind is my love to-day").  --Lambiam 20:08, 17 January 2023 (UTC)[reply]

Many a poem on the Internet not written by Shakespeare is called a "Shakespeare-style sonnet".[4][5][6] The model does not "know" that in these cases the label "Shakespeare-style sonnet" refers to a specific nearby piece of text; the association of the label with some text having the pattern of three ABAB quatrains plus a couplet, all in iambic pentameters, is supposedly purely statistical. The tonal contrast between the first two and the last two stanzas you mentioned above is at least as striking. It is purely semantic in nature, but perfectly appropriate. How did that emerge from a statistical analysis of sequences of tokens?  --Lambiam 08:45, 19 January 2023 (UTC)[reply]
